CHARLES AMHERST'S ALMSHOUSES 

Maintenance of almshouses for elderly residents.
Analysis by Giving is Great

Positives:

  • There has been strong growth in spending over the last 5 years, despite a decline more recently
  • There have been no material income shortfalls in recent years
  • The Board appears to be well diversified in terms of gender and dynamic in terms of composition

Regulatory & Governance issues to consider:

  • This charity does not have a Conflict of Interests policy
  • Over half the Board have joined recently

Financial issues to consider:

  • A PartB annual return has not been required and so detailed financial information is not available from the online data

Objectives

ALMSHOUSES FOR OLD BLIND OR IMPOTENT PERSONS WHO HAVE RESIDED IN THE ANCIENT PARISH OF PEMBURY FOR NOT LESS THAN TWO YEARS NEXT PRECEDING THE TIME OF APPOINTMENT. ANY SURPLUS INCOME TO BE APPLIED FOR BENEFIT OF ALMSPEOPLE.

Defined Area of Benefit:

ANCIENT PARISH OF PEMBURY
